El ser humano se conforma de 8 grandes pilares, estos deben estar en equilibrio para que podamos avanzar en nuestros planes y sueños. Para ello es importante mantener el enfoque y discernir ante las prioridades de la vida. Joao Mucciolo (Fundador de EO Nicaragua), nos cuenta de su experiencia de cómo ha sido para el enfocarse en lo que realmente importa y nos comparte cuáles son esos 8 pilares. 00:35 - Inicio del Episodio  1:33 - El primer contacto con EO 3:00 - ¿Cómo nace Joao el emprendedor? 4:33 - El enfoque del emprendedor (el discernimiento) 8:35 - ¿Cómo has definido tu plan de vida?  13:30 - La rueda de la vida 17:15 - La vida te avisa cuando estás perdiendo el enfoque 20:00 - ¿Cómo identificas en qué negocio enfocarte?  26:00 - ¿Cómo instaurar valores en tu modelo de negocio? 27:00 - ¿Cuál es tu rutina diaria? 30:20 - ¿Qué le aconsejarías a un emprendedor desenfocado? 31:45 - ¿Cómo dar el paso para entrar a EO? 33:05 - Cierre (La Crisis) Referencias bibliográficas: Michael Hyatt & Co. https://michaelhyatt.com/creating-a-life-plan/ Scaling Up - Verne Harnish Para mayor información puedes contactarnos a: [email protected]
